The Port of San Diego has reached its 50 year anniversary as the agency in 1962 was created by the state legislature. The port is in charge of the environmental steward of 6,000 acres around the San Diego Bay and Downtown San Diego (Chula Vista, Coronado, Imperial Beach, National City and San Diego) to create community service and Continue…

Freddie Mac and their latest survey are showing that the 30-year fixed mortgage rates have been lowered this week to 3.32 percent compared to lasts weeks rate of 3.34 percent. The 3.32 percent is close to the record low number of 3.31 percent we have seen this past year. Freddie Mac also reports that the Continue…

A total of 275 homes were sold during the 3rd quarter of 2012 where 145 homes were financed and 130 homes were bought with cash. The financial breakdown of Downtown San Diego Condos and Downtown San Diego Lofts sold in the 3rd quarter of 2012 shows that out of 145 homes financed 124 homes (85%) belonged to the conforming range up Continue…
